Roof Repair and Installation FAQs

You should repair your roof if the damage is minor, such as a few missing shingles or a small leak.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of your roof. However, if the damage is extensive or your roof is old, it may be time to replace it. A professional roofer can inspect your roof and advise you on whether repair or replacement is necessary.

You should inspect your roof at least once a year, preferably in the spring or fall, to check for damage, wear and tear, and any potential issues. You can also inspect your roof after a severe storm, especially if there was hail, high winds, or heavy rain.

Some common signs that your roof needs repair or replacement include missing or cracked shingles, leaks, water stains on your ceiling, sagging, and mold or mildew growth. You may also notice granules from your shingles collecting in your gutters or around the perimeter of your home.

The cost of roof repair or installation can depend on several factors, such as the size and slope of the roof, the type of materials used, and the extent of the damage or repairs needed. The cost may also vary depending on the location, as prices may differ between urban and rural areas.

There are many types of roofing materials available, including asphalt shingles, metal, slate, tile, and wood. Each material has its advantages and disadvantages in terms of durability, cost, and aesthetics. It's essential to choose a material that suits your home's design, location, and climate.

The lifespan of a roof can vary depending on the type of material used, climate, and maintenance. Most roofs last between 15 and 50 years. Asphalt shingle roofs typically last 15 to 30 years, while metal, tile, and slate roofs can last 50 years or more. Regular maintenance and prompt repairs can help extend the lifespan of your roof.

You can maintain your roof by cleaning out gutters regularly, removing any debris, trimming overhanging branches, and inspecting it for damage regularly. It's also crucial to remove any moss, algae, or lichen growth, as they can cause damage to the shingles. If you notice any damage or wear, you should contact a professional roofer to make repairs promptly.

The amount of time it takes to repair or install a roof can depend on factors such as the size and slope of the roof, the type of materials used, and the extent of the damage or repairs needed. A simple repair or partial replacement may only take a few hours or a day, while a complete replacement may take several days or even weeks, depending on the size and complexity of the job, weather conditions, and the availability of materials and equipment.

If your roof was damaged by a covered peril, such as a storm, fire, or vandalism, you may be able to claim the repair or replacement costs on your home insurance. However, if the damage was due to wear and tear or neglect, it may not be covered. It's best to review your policy and contact your insurance provider to understand your coverage and options. It's also important to note that filing a claim can impact your premium and deductible, so you should consider the costs and benefits before doing so.
